Jinan Steel to integrate melting and steel plate plants

Tuesday, 06 March 2012 16:32:55 (GMT+3)   |  
Shandong Province-based Chinese steelmaker Jinan Iron and Steel Company (Jinan Steel) has announced that it plans to integrate its melting plant with its steel plate plant.
 
The plate plant of Jinan Steel was put into production in February 1998. In 2001, it went through an upgrading project, with a new 3,500 mm finishing mill added. Accordingly, the plant, with its 2,500 mm medium plate mill and its new finishing mill, saw its total annual steel plate production capacity increase to 3.6 million mt, including 1.8 million mt of shipbuilding plate. In May 2010, Jinan Steel commissioned a third plate mill at its steel plate plant, with an annual output capacity of 1.8 million mt.
